Hi — quick recap of last night's cut-over for the Plannery query engine. We rolled back the cost-model change that caused the regression, re-ran the benchmark suite, and everything's green. Nothing security-relevant changed in auth paths, but flagging for your review anyway. The planner now runs with the settings below.

settings of fafog-haduf:
ZORIX_PIN=4648
ZORIX_METRICS_HOST=metrics.zorix.paliqsys.corp
ZORIX_LOG_LEVEL=info
ZORIX_TENANT=druix

Hi Maren,

Handing over StageGrid, the seat-map renderer for the Velvettine Theatre client. Current state: balcony tiers render fine, but the new wraparound boxes occasionally overlap aisle labels at zoom level 3. There's a mitigation flag (legacy_layout) you can flip per venue if anyone complains. The render cache was purged this morning, so first loads will be slow until noon. Deploys are frozen until the Thursday release train. Pager rotation doc is on the wiki. For anything urgent overnight, reach the platform duty desk here.

pager mailbox: norwyn@zarqelforge.corp

**Action Item 3: Add dead-man monitoring to the reminder job**

During the Pinefield Clinic incident, the appointment reminder job on Quillbatch failed silently for two days because its scheduler entry was disabled during a migration and nobody noticed. New team members should know this job has no retry path: a missed run means patients simply never get reminded. We will add a dead-man switch that pages if the job hasn't reported success within 26 hours. The alert wiring steps are documented on the internal runbook page.

runbook for badug-kadup: https://confluence.zemvarlabs.internal/projects/browse/display/projects/bd1b